As the TES Construction Manager you are a customer obsessed leader in the Amazon construction
process. In this role you play an integral part in the implementation of the facility network infrastructure;
including sortation centers delivery stations and auxiliary buildings that support those facilities. The
construction projects include new builds retrofits and expansions. You are required to perform detailed
deep dive reviews of job budgets and schedules to identify and resolve any discrepancies including
information in contractor bid packages. You will partner with internal customers and external
stakeholders to earn their trust and engage as a team to deliver results. You must ensure information is
communicated to internal and external stakeholders in an effective and timely manner. Some key
competencies of this position include; insist on the highest standards ensure contracted resources deliver
work that meets duration and quality targets coach developers design engineers contractors during the
project duration seek better ways to serve Amazon customers influence internal stakeholders while
holding them accountable for their actions ensure all internal and external team members maintain
proposed schedules and budgets help to invent and simplify innovative solutions that allow for improved
processes and results while working on multiple projects in various locations. This opportunity combines
construction engineering planning project management facilities management and contract
management. The TES Construction Manager position includes approximately 60 travel in North
America
Key job responsibilities
Supervise the implementation and management of Amazons safety programs and standards with
the entire internal and external project team
Manage multiple projects simultaneously
Ensure that the skills and competencies of contract labor are appropriate to need and fit to
undertake the work
Operate independently in the assigned role and region; interacting with leadership and
stakeholders to resolve issues
Comprehensive budget and schedule tracking and cashflow forecasting.
Identify and solve for factors that may impede a successful project handover to Amazon
stakeholders while striving for frugality and accomplishing more with less
Interface and coordinate with the authorities that have jurisdiction (AHJ) on projects to maintain
regulatory compliance and seamless job
Advise on the impact of changes in schedule costs and permitting.
Maintain internal and external stakeholders uptodate on pertinent information through
comprehensive and timely written and oral communication
A day in the life
Each day you will act as an owner at TES to ensure the safe ontime and inbudget of Amazon
construction projects. Daily tasks may be comprised of:
Site management: coordination with contractors on projected changes and project status
Ensure contractors are meeting contractual obligations
Seek sustainable environmentallyfriendly solutions throughout the construction process while
implementing Amazons environmentally friendly building practices
Utilize Amazon information systems to record and update schedule budget and other key
developments
Negotiate contract terms with vendors while driving partners to meet or exceed agreedto
schedules and budgets
Participate in weekly Architect Owner and Contractor (AOC) meetings and provide input on root
causes and corrective actions
